If you create a report on the GenoPro site and then go to http://collaboration.genopro.com/Account.aspx you can then make the report Password protected which should satisfy family members who do not want details published. You can also make the file hidden which is another layer of secrecy.
A smartphone will then be able to see the report in a browser, (as long as you remember the password!)

We are all waiting (and waiting) for the multi-platform, including mobile, GenoProX to materialise but there is no real indication at present as to when that might happen. 

You can find a little bit about its development and progress on this forum such as Status Updates or try searching for GenoProX.

I have produced a 'Web app' called GenoTab for viewing your existing GenoPro data on mobiles and tablets. See Introducing GenoTab.

Smartphone/tablet support is in GenoProX.  One of the major features that we invest time in is Multi Device support for the same profile.  That said, We will definitely release PC Mac/Windows/Linux beta releases before we release SmartPhone/Tablet beta releases.  This is primarily because the vast majority of our current customer base will use GenoProX on a PC.  The core itself has been tested on SmartPhones, actually on a fairly old Galaxy 5, and even on a older Google Nexus S (7 year old phone)  But at the moment we are not investing time on the SmartPhone/tablet UI.  Our main short term goal is to get a Beta release out that you can start using.
